How to fill out temporary order of protection

Illustration

How to fill out Temporary Order of Protection

01
Obtain the form: Visit your local courthouse or their website to download the Temporary Order of Protection form.
02
Read the instructions: Review all instructions to understand the requirements for filling out the application.
03
Fill out personal information: Provide your name, address, and contact details, along with information about the respondent (the person you are seeking protection from).
04
Detail incidents: Clearly describe the incidents of abuse or harassment, including dates, locations, and any witnesses if applicable.
05
State your request: Specify what protections you are seeking, such as no contact orders or residence exclusion.
06
Sign and date: Ensure you sign and date the application before submitting it.
07
File the application: Submit your completed application to the court clerk and request a hearing date.
08
Prepare for the hearing: Gather any evidence or witnesses to support your case for the hearing.

The TRO lays out both restrictions on the behavior of the defendant and actions they must take. For example, a TRO may instruct the defendant to move out of the home they share with the plaintiff, stay away from the plaintiff's workplace, obtain drug addiction counseling, and pay child support.
temporary restraining order. A temporary restraining order (TRO) is a short-term pre-trial temporary injunction. To obtain a TRO, a party must convince the judge that they will suffer immediate irreparable injury unless the order is issued.
If you are afraid the other party will do something harmful before the temporary orders hearing, you can ask the judge to sign a temporary restraining order (TRO). A TRO is an emergency court order that orders a party not to take some particular action until a hearing can be held.

A Temporary Order of Protection is a legal order issued by a court to protect an individual from harassment, abuse, or threats by another individual, usually in domestic or family situations.
Typically, any individual who feels threatened, harassed, or endangered by another person can file for a Temporary Order of Protection, often including victims of domestic violence.
To fill out a Temporary Order of Protection, you should obtain the appropriate forms from the court, provide necessary personal information, describe the incidents that led to the request, and outline the protections you are seeking.
The purpose of a Temporary Order of Protection is to provide immediate safety and legal protection to individuals who are experiencing threats, harassment, or violence from another person.
The information that must be reported typically includes personal details of both the petitioner and the respondent, detailed descriptions of the incidents prompting the request, and specific protections sought, such as no-contact orders.
